Asphalt Shingles Installation Questions
What are asphalt shingles? Asphalt shingles are a popular roofing material made from a fiberglass or organic mat coated with asphalt and mineral granules, providing durability and weather resistance.
How do asphalt shingles improve roof durability? They protect the roof from rain, wind, and UV rays, helping to extend the lifespan of the roof structure.
What types of asphalt shingles are available? Options include three-tab shingles, architectural (laminate) shingles, and luxury shingles, each offering different styles and levels of durability.
Are asphalt shingles suitable for different roof styles? Yes, asphalt shingles can be installed on various roof shapes and pitches, making them versatile for many property types.
